Hit the link in my sigline to his website... there's a lot of pics of some of his work, dyno charts from "before Patrick" and "after Patrick"... unbelievable. He's so painstaking in his work, and his attention to detail is almost scary. It's really cool to watch him fabricate parts, too!

I was just over there last night, while he did a valve adjustment on my bike. He took the time to explain what he was doing, which taught me a lot. Dunno how much I retained, but it was cool learning new stuff. Watching him measure the clearances, then doing compression testing and clearing carbon out, and how that then changed the measurements... I can't imagine a lot of shops take the time to take all those steps... but I'll tell you what- the man is worth every penny.
